Lottery signs new media awards deal

- Paul Sheridan

THE National Lottery has signed up to sponsor NewsBrands Ireland’s annual Journalism Awards with a new three-year deal.

The awards will take place in Dublin’s Mansion House on November 14 and feature a total of 26 categories spanning all areas and discipline­s of modern journalism.

Entry to the Journalism Awards is open to any work published in print, website, online, mobile, video, audio or any other news delivery format from any NewsBrands Ireland member title.

This year sees the addition of three new digital categories: Best News Website/App, Podcast of the Year and Best Use of Video.

Tim Vaughan has been announced as the new chair of the judging panel. A former editor of the Irish Examiner for more than 15 years, he is now head of content and corporate communicat­ions at the global employee communicat­ions company, Poppulo.

Speaking about his new role, Tim said: “Despite the challenges journalism is under, there’s really outstandin­g work being done across the newspaper sector, week in, week out. So, it’s great that NewsBrands are showcasing the very best of Irish journalism and it’s an honour to have been asked to chair the judging panel.”

Commenting at the launch of this year’s awards, Vincent Crowley, chairman of NewsBrands Ireland, said: “We are delighted to welcome Tim Vaughan as our new judging panel chairperso­n. Tim’s vast experience, knowledge and integrity will be of great benefit to the entire judging process.

“Thanks once again to all in the National Lottery for their continued support.”

Dermot Griffin, chief executive of the National Lottery, said: “The National Lottery is honoured to continue to sponsor the Journalism Awards for the next three years. We have a very successful partnershi­p with NewsBrands Ireland and we are delighted to be involved in this important awards initiative.”

The eligibilit­y period for this year’s NewsBrands Ireland Journalism Awards is from July 1, 2018, to June 30, 2019.

Entries will open in July 2019.
